FDNY Pipes and Drums Holds Election for Executive Board

The FDNY Pipes and Drums held its Bi-Yearly election for the executive board positions. All but one of the incumbents was re-elected into their positions. The Secretary for the past two years and former Chairman Jim McEnenany decided not to seek re-election so he could spend more time on the golf course and less time in front of a computer screen. Jim Lee from Ladder 147 will take Jim's place for the next 2 years.

 The rest of the Executive Board is as follows: Chairman Liam Flaherty of SOC, Vice Chairman Brian Grogan of the Queens FM Base, Treasurer Brian Kearney of L30, Quartermaster Kevin O'Hagan of the Marine Division, Drum Sergeant Ted Carstensen of L40, and Pipe Major Jerry Brengel of E287.

Pipe Major Jerry Brengel of E287 has announced his Pipe Sergeants for the next year.  

They are, Butch Scarpinato of E289, Billy Woods of L38, Joe Killeen of R3, Joe Duggan of the 8th Division, and our newest Pipe Sergeant Brian McMahon of E35. Congratulations to all the new members of the leadership team of the FDNY Pipes and Drums.
